Understanding Window Repair
Before diving into the very best window repair services, it's crucial to understand the types of window issues that may arise and how they can be attended to:
| Type of Window Issue | Description | Suggested Repair |
|---|---|---|
| Broken Glass | Noticeable fractures that can intensify gradually. | Replace the glass pane. |
| Leaking Windows | Water intrusion resulting in home damage. | Reseal windows or change caulking. |
| Foggy Glass | Condensation caught between panes. | Replace the insulated glass system (IGU). |
| Broken Window Locks | Security threat and potential for burglaries. | Repair or change window locks. |
| Damaged Frames | Rotting wood or cracked vinyl. | Repair frame or replace the whole window. |

Quick Tips for DIY Window Repairs
While some window concerns need professional assistance, a couple of minor repairs can be taken on by the property owner:
- Clean and Reseal: Regularly inspect the caulking around windows and reseal as needed to avoid leakages.
- Replace Hardware: If locks or handles are broken, changing them can greatly enhance security.
- Weatherstripping: Replace used weatherstripping to improve energy effectiveness.

F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TION: Your Window Repair Questions Answered
Q1: How do I understand if my window needs repair or replacement?
A1: If the window has minor problems like a crack or broken lock, repair is typically adequate. Nevertheless, if the frame is rotting or the glass is foggy and can not be repaired, replacement might be necessary.
Q2: What are the signs of window leaks?
A2: Look for water stains on walls or ceilings, drafts, or visible mold development around window frames.
Q3: How long does a typical window repair take?
A3: Most window repairs can be finished within a couple of hours, but complicated issues might take a full day or longer.
Q4: Are there energy-efficient window repair choices?
A4: Yes, numerous business use energy-efficient upgrades, such as low-E glass or enhanced insulation, which can lower heating and cooling costs.
